Wheel Arch and Sill Trim
- The Front Wheel Arch Trim - side panel, is retained to the body mounted side panel by means of four clips.
- The Front Wheel Arch Trim - hood is secured to the hood by three clips and one plastic nut, accessed with the hood open. Removal of the trim requires pressing the clips through the hood from the engine side.
- The Front Wheel Arch Trim - front bumper is secured to the front bumper cover by one screw at the top edge with four plastic clips. There is an additional bolt on the lower edge securing the finisher to the front bumper cover bib spoiler.
- The Rear Wheel Arch Trim is retained to the body rear quarter panel with five female clips with welded studs on the body wheel arch and one male clip into the body.
- The Sill Trim is held by a total of twenty four attachments; Eleven clips along the body sill side face, four screws along the door opening tread strip and eight threaded clips along the body sill floor face with one screw at the rear going into the rear wheel arch liner.
